Я не могу получить StageWebViewBridge для загрузки внешних ресурсов - PullRequest
0 голосов
/ 10 сентября 2011

Я использую appfile:/. Путь правильный; если я помещу это на экран и скопирую и вставлю это в проводнике, это связывается с изображением.

Что еще мне нужно сделать?

Ответы [ 3 ]

1 голос
/ 15 сентября 2011

ОБНОВЛЕНО Я обновил библиотеку, теперь стало проще в использовании. Можете ли вы проверить это?

Я являюсь автором класса StageWebViewBridge. Существует известная проблема, если вы используете Android. В любом случае, у меня есть рабочее решение, которое я обновлю на следующей неделе.

Если проблема не в Android, пришлите мне код.

0 голосов
/ 11 ноября 2011

Получил ту же проблему и исправил ее с помощью "appfile: /"

Зачем вам нужен "appfile: / для локального файла HTML?

  • ЕслиЛеченый html / js / css является локальным, а ресурс относительным (он же ../ или нет http://), вы должны рассматривать их как "appfile: /"?

  • Если обработанный файлдалекой, вам не нужно обрабатывать активы?

Есть ли лучшая практика для работы с "appfile: /"?

На самом деле я отлаживаю свой html / js / cssигра в браузере, но если я использую appfile: / он больше не будет работать. Мне придется обрабатывать 2 поведения.

0 голосов
/ 16 сентября 2011

Я также не совсем понимаю, как получить доступ к локально упакованным ресурсам.Я помещаю их в папку HTML по запросу, и когда я посылаю сигнал в StageWebViewBridge, чтобы установить атрибут .src видео, я не уверен, как это сделать.

Без StageWebViewBridge и полностью на веб-сайтеЯ могу просто ссылаться на файл для видео объекта через JavaScript напрямую, например, swvRef.src = 'file.mp4' ;.Это прекрасно работает.Когда я пытаюсь заставить Flash отправлять вызов через StageWebViewBridge, он получает вызов к StageWebView (у меня JavaScript сообщает об этом).Однако, когда я пытаюсь установить .src видео объекта, я не могу определить правильный путь.

В документации сказано, что все нужно поместить в папку «html».Я так и сделал.Никакая ссылка на .src «html / a.mp4» или «a.mp4» или «htmlCache / a.mp4» никогда не заставляет работать новый класс видео javascript html5.

В противном случае мост отлично работает, отправляя AS-> JS и JS-> AS.Я просто ищу информацию о том, как ссылаться на упакованные файлы.Я хочу воспроизвести видео, помещенное в папку / html, и пока не могу этого сделать.

...